Dhurandhar 2 Box Office Collection: Bollywood Is Just Hours Away From Its First-Ever 1100 Crore Net Milestone Even As BMS Sales Drop By 50% From Yesterday

BY CHRISTA LINCY

The box office journey of Dhurandhar 2: The Revenge has reached its twenty-eighth day, providing a stark look at the contrast between holiday momentum and mid-week working day realities. After a phenomenal performance on Tuesday, which was bolstered by the national holiday of Ambedkar Jayanti, the film is now navigating the typical post-holiday Wednesday blues. While the film remains a dominant force in its fourth week, the latest ticket sales data suggests a significant cooling off as audiences return to their regular schedules. Analyzing the critical windows of ticket sales on BookMyShow over the last three days reveals the shifting momentum of the film as it navigates its fourth week: • 4th Monday (April 13): The film registered a robust full-day total of 103.97K tickets on BMS. During the 8 PM to 9 PM window, it recorded 6,670 ticket sales, with the cumulative total from 8 AM reaching 67,400 tickets by that hour. • 4th Tuesday (April 14 - Holiday): Driven by the Ambedkar Jayanti holiday, the film hit a weekly peak of 107.92K tickets for the day. Even in the late night 10 PM to 11 PM window, it sold 2,700 tickets, with the cumulative sales from 8 AM to 11 PM totaling a massive 84,550 tickets. • 4th Wednesday (April 15 - Today): As of the 3 PM to 4 PM afternoon slot, the film recorded 3,450 ticket sales. The current total from 8 AM to 4 PM stands at 27,710 tickets, reflecting a standard mid-week stabilization after the holiday surge. In terms of live collections, the film is currently running across 6,145 shows nationwide. As of the latest reports for Day 28 (up to 4 PM), Dhurandhar 2: The Revenge has collected a live net of ₹1.72 Cr. This brings the total India net collection to approximately ₹1,097.39 Cr, while the total India gross has climbed to ₹1,313.71 Cr. Despite the mid-week drop, these cumulative figures remain in the stratosphere of Indian cinema as the film is now just ₹2.61 Cr away from the monumental ₹1,100 Cr net milestone. Given the current velocity, the film is poised to officially breach this historic finish line either in the late-night shows tonight or within the first few hours of tomorrow morning. (adsbygoogle = window.adsbygoogle || []).push({}) The impending milestone carries immense historical weight, as it marks the first time a Bollywood production has ever breached the ₹1,100 Cr net threshold in the Indian market. This staggering total is anchored by an extraordinary performance in the primary Hindi market, which alone has contributed a massive ₹1,031.01 Cr toward the total. Such an overwhelming contribution from a single language market underscores the incredible power and scale of the Hindi-speaking audience. By crossing this mark within the next few hours, the film will officially stand alone as the first-ever Bollywood production to reach this echelon of success, proving that the domestic potential for Hindi cinema has reached an unprecedented new gold standard. Looking ahead to the conclusion of Day 28, the film is projected to end the day with a net collection in the range of ₹2.50 Cr to ₹2.80 Cr. While this is a sharp decline from the holiday-boosted Tuesday, it is a standard stabilization for a film in its fourth week. The franchise's unprecedented reach has ensured that even on a slow Wednesday, the film is outperforming the lifetime daily collections of most major releases at this stage of their theatrical run. All eyes now remain on the upcoming weekend to see if the film can find one last major surge before the end of its month-long historic run.

Kartik Aaryan's Much-Awaited Naagzilla Officially Postponed; Locks February 12, 2027, As A New Release Date

BY SUNIT JANGIR

Mumbai, April 15 - Kartik Aaryan's much-awaited fantasy entertainer Naagzilla has officially been postponed from its August 2026 release. The makers have locked a new release date, with the film now set to arrive during the Valentine's Day 2027 week. Directed by Mrighdeep Singh Lamba, the film will be released on February 12, 2027. It is produced by Dharma Productions and Mahaveer Jain Films. Backed by Karan Johar, Apoorva Mehta, and Mahaveer Jain, Naagzilla is being mounted on a grand scale. (adsbygoogle = window.adsbygoogle || []).push({}) The shift from an Independence Day 2026 window to February 2027 suggests a strategic move by the makers, possibly to allow more time for post-production or to position the film better at the box office. The film explores a unique fantasy-comedy concept revolving around a shape-shifting serpent With a fresh release timeline and a visually intriguing concept, Naagzilla continues to build curiosity among fans. All eyes are now on the makers for further announcements, including teasers, cast details, and more insights into this ambitious fantasy venture. Stay tuned...

Ramayana Storms CinemaCon: Global Giants Take Notice as India's Biggest Film Aims for Historic Worldwide Breakthrough

BY CHRISTA LINCY

The much-anticipated mythological epic Ramayana has made a powerful impact at CinemaCon, signaling a major shift in how Indian films are being positioned on the global stage. A widely circulated invite by exhibition industry veteran John Fithian called attendees to experience the world of Ramayana at the Milano III Ballroom, where exclusive footage and presentations were showcased. The tone of the message was clear and confident, suggesting that the film is not just another large-scale Indian production but a serious attempt at creating a truly global blockbuster that can stand alongside the biggest Hollywood franchises. This presence at CinemaCon was not symbolic but strategic, as the makers organized private screenings, industry interactions, and large-scale presentations aimed at key distributors and exhibitors from across North America, Europe, Latin America, and Australia. Such a focused international outreach is rarely seen for an Indian film at this level and highlights the intent to secure a wide and impactful global release. The film's positioning among major Hollywood titles at the event further reinforced its ambition to compete on a worldwide scale rather than being confined to regional success. Producer Namit Malhotra played a central role in communicating this vision, emphasizing that global audiences are now actively seeking fresh stories and new cultural perspectives. He described Ramayana as a project that blends universal emotions with cutting-edge technology, aiming to deliver an experience that resonates across borders. His statements reflected a strong belief that Indian storytelling, when presented with the right scale and technical finesse, has the potential to achieve global dominance and redefine industry benchmarks. Adding to the excitement, actor Yash, who portrays Ravana in the film, also contributed to the growing buzz with insights into the narrative structure and character treatment. It was revealed that the first part of the film may explore parallel arcs, with limited direct interaction between key characters early on, suggesting a layered storytelling approach that builds towards a larger conflict. Early glimpses and visual material showcased at the event reportedly impressed attendees, particularly in terms of costume design, world-building, and visual effects quality. (adsbygoogle = window.adsbygoogle || []).push({}) Directed by Nitesh Tiwari, Ramayana is being developed as a two-part cinematic epic with a scale that is unprecedented in Indian cinema. The film features Ranbir Kapoor as Lord Ram, Sai Pallavi as Sita, and Yash as Ravana, forming a powerful ensemble cast that combines star power with strong acting credibility. The project is backed by major production houses and international collaborators, ensuring that both creative and technical aspects meet global standards. One of the most talked-about aspects of the film is its massive budget, which is reported to be among the highest ever for an Indian production. This financial scale is being utilized to create world-class visual effects, detailed set designs, and immersive storytelling techniques that aim to rival top-tier global films. The makers are also investing heavily in advanced technology, including high-end VFX pipelines and innovative cinematic tools, to ensure that the film delivers a visually spectacular experience. The musical dimension of Ramayana further elevates its global appeal, with legendary composer AR Rahman collaborating with internationally acclaimed composer Hans Zimmer. This rare partnership is expected to produce a powerful and emotionally resonant soundtrack that complements the film's grand narrative while also appealing to international audiences. The release strategy is equally ambitious, with the first part scheduled for a Diwali 2026 release followed by the second instalment in 2027. The makers are planning a wide multi-language release along with advanced dubbing and localization techniques to ensure accessibility across global markets. This approach reflects a clear intention to position Ramayana not just as an Indian film but as a worldwide cinematic event.

Baahubali: The Eternal War Marks A Big Global Break With Prestigious Annecy Festival Selection

BY SUNIT JANGIR

Mumbai, April 15 - In a significant boost for Indian animation on the global stage, Baahubali: The Eternal War – Part 1 has been selected for the "Work in Progress" showcase at the prestigious Annecy International Animation Film Festival 2026. Widely regarded as the world's most important animation festival, Annecy serves as a global launchpad for some of the most celebrated animated films. The film's inclusion in the Work in Progress lineup places it among a curated selection of international projects currently in production, offering a rare behind-the-scenes look at evolving animated features. The 2026 edition will feature 16 standout projects from across the globe, reflecting diverse storytelling styles and cutting-edge animation techniques. (adsbygoogle = window.adsbygoogle || []).push({}) This milestone marks a major moment not just for the Baahubali franchise, but for Indian mainstream cinema, which is increasingly gaining recognition in the global animation space. The project, backed by Arka Media Works and spearheaded by franchise creator S. S. Rajamouli, has been in development for several years and represents an ambitious expansion of the beloved universe. Directed by Ishan Shukla, the film is a large-scale international collaboration involving studios from India, the UK, and France. With a reported budget of around 120 crore and a planned 2027 release, the animated epic aims to push the boundaries of Indian storytelling with a global visual language. Set after the events of Baahubali: The Beginning, the story explores Amarendra Baahubali's journey through mythical realms and cosmic battles, expanding the saga into a grand, mythological fantasy. Force 3 Is On: John Abraham, Harshvardhan Rane Begin Shoot for 2027 Release

BY CHRISTA LINCY

The much-awaited third instalment of the Force franchise Force 3 is officially underway with John Abraham Harshvardhan Rane and Tanya Maniktala leading the film. The shoot has commenced and the project is already deep into its first schedule indicating a well-planned production timeline. The makers have locked 19 March 2027 as the theatrical release date positioning the film as a major action event on the calendar and raising expectations among fans of the franchise. Directed by Bhav Dhulia the film marks a new phase for the Force universe as it attempts to reinvent itself while staying rooted in its core identity of gritty action and intense storytelling. The project is backed by a strong production team including John Abraham Sheel Kumar Shahbaz Alam Sandeep Leyzell and Minnakshi Das. With Ravi Basrur handling the music the film is expected to carry a powerful background score that complements its action-heavy narrative and enhances the theatrical experience. The initial shooting schedule has taken place in Gujarat with a major portion focusing on Harshvardhan Rane and Tanya Maniktala. This approach suggests that the film may open with new character arcs before bringing John Abraham into the central conflict. John who joined during the mahurat ceremony is expected to feature prominently in the upcoming schedules where the narrative is likely to shift into a larger action-driven space. The Force franchise has had a mixed but interesting journey at the box office which makes the third instalment even more crucial. The first film Force introduced audiences to ACP Yashvardhan Singh and went on to collect around 36.66 crore India gross with a worldwide total of 40.28 crore while the India net stood at 27.16 crore. Despite its strong action appeal and eventual cult following the film was declared a flop during its theatrical run although it gained popularity later through television and digital platforms. (adsbygoogle = window.adsbygoogle || []).push({}) The sequel Force 2 attempted to expand the scale by introducing an international espionage angle and a more stylized treatment. The film recorded an India gross of 48.20 crore and a worldwide total of 58.70 crore with 10.50 crore coming from overseas markets while the India net closed at 35.70 crore. However despite the improved numbers the film was again declared a flop which highlighted the challenges the franchise faced in converting scale into commercial success. With Force 3 the makers are aiming to change that narrative by combining the raw intensity of the first film with the scale and ambition of the second. The addition of new cast members and a fresh director indicates a conscious effort to evolve the storytelling while retaining the core character of ACP Yashvardhan Singh who remains central to the franchise. John Abraham returns to reprise his role as ACP Yashvardhan Singh a character that has become synonymous with his action image. Over the years John has established himself as one of the most reliable action stars in Bollywood with films like Pathaan further strengthening his box office pull and screen presence. His return ensures continuity while also providing a solid foundation for the new narrative. Harshvardhan Rane enters the franchise at a crucial point in his career as he rides strong momentum. His film Sanam Teri Kasam found renewed success over time and built a loyal fan base while Ek Deewane Ki Deewaniyat delivered a successful theatrical run crossing the 100 crore mark worldwide. Known for his intense performances and emotional depth Harshvardhan is expected to bring a different energy to the franchise possibly as a parallel lead or a character with shades of grey. Reports also suggest that he is undergoing a significant physical transformation to match the action demands of the film. (adsbygoogle = window.adsbygoogle || []).push({}) Tanya Maniktala adds freshness to the cast with her growing popularity across films and streaming platforms. After gaining attention for her performances in projects like A Suitable Boy and Kill she has proven her ability to handle both emotional and intense roles. In Force 3 she is expected to play a significant part in the storyline potentially adding emotional weight or being directly involved in the central conflict. Director Bhav Dhulia is known for his grounded and realistic storytelling especially in the crime drama space. His work in Khakee The Bihar Chapter was appreciated for its gripping narrative and character depth which suggests that Force 3 may focus more on story-driven action rather than just spectacle. This could be a key factor in helping the franchise connect better with audiences this time. The music and background score by Ravi Basrur is expected to play a crucial role in defining the film's tone. Known for creating high-impact soundtracks that elevate action sequences he could add a distinct identity to Force 3 making it stand out in a crowded action genre. With the shoot progressing steadily and the release date locked Force 3 is shaping up to be a crucial film not just for the franchise but also for its lead actors. After two films that underperformed commercially the third instalment carries the responsibility of delivering both critical and box office success. If executed well it has the potential to revive the franchise and establish it as a consistent action brand in Bollywood.

Vaazha 2 Box Office: Hashir Starrer Storms Past 100 Crore Domestically To Become 7th Malayalam Movie To Do So

BY SUNIT JANGIR

Kochi, April 15 - Hashir-fronted coming-of-age comedy drama Vaazha 2: Biopic of a Billion Bros has emerged as a sensational blockbuster, continuing its dream run at the box office. The film has now crossed the 100 crore mark at the Indian box office, cementing its place among the biggest Mollywood hits of all time. Vaazha 2 has collected approximately 101.30 crore gross in India in 13 days so far, with a net total of 87.50 crore, reflecting its strong hold even in the second week. What makes this achievement even more remarkable is the consistency of its daily collections, driven by exceptional word-of-mouth and repeat audience footfall. (adsbygoogle = window.adsbygoogle || []).push({}) Seventh Malayalam Film To Cross 100 Crore Domestically With this milestone, Vaazha 2 has become only the 7th Malayalam film of all-time to breach the 100 crore mark domestically, joining an elite league of top-performing Mollywood blockbusters. Mohanlal's Pulimurugan was the first film to achieve this historic feat in 2016. Vaazha 2's dominance has been particularly evident in Kerala, where it has already amassed over 90 crore and is set to cross the 100 crore mark in a couple of days. Highest Grossing Malayalam Films in India (Gross) S. No. Movie India Gross 1 Lokah Chapter 1 ₹ 184 Cr 2 Manjummel Boys ₹ 167.65 Cr 3 Thudarum ₹ 141.60 Cr 4 Empuraan ₹ 124.50 Cr 5 2018 Movie ₹ 110.50 Cr 6 Vaazha 2 ₹ 101.30 Cr 7 Pulimurugan ₹ 100 Cr As of April 14, 2026. (adsbygoogle = window.adsbygoogle || []).push({}) A Box Office Juggernaut Worldwide Globally, the blockbuster sequel has been equally phenomenal. The worldwide gross has already hit the 176 crore range, including nearly 75 crores at the overseas box office in 13 days, making it one of the highest-grossing Malayalam films ever and putting it on track to challenge even bigger records in the coming days. Vaazha 2 had earlier crossed 100 crore worldwide in just 7 days, and became one of the fastest Malayalam films to achieve the milestone. Its rapid rise, combined with sustained collections in week two, highlights its massive popularity among youth and family audiences alike. (adsbygoogle = window.adsbygoogle || []).push({}) Top Malayalam Grossers Worldwide S. No. Movie Worldwide Gross 1 Lokah Chapter 1 ₹ 303.85 Cr 2 L2: Empuraan ₹ 266.80 Cr 3 Manjummel Boys ₹ 241.00 Cr 4 Thudarum ₹ 235.40 Cr 5 2018 ₹ 180.00 Cr 6 Vaazha 2 ₹ 176.00 Cr 7 Aadujeevitham ₹ 157.60 Cr 8 Aavesham ₹ 154.80 Cr 9 Sarvam Maya ₹ 151.25 Cr 10 Pulimurugan ₹ 139.50 Cr As of April 14, 2026. (adsbygoogle = window.adsbygoogle || []).push({}) What's Next? With minimal competition and strong occupancy trends, Vaazha 2 is set to enter the 200 crore worldwide club this coming weekend, which would further solidify its blockbuster status and franchise value. With the worldwide trend remaining strong, the film will aim to finish its global run at around 250 crores.

Bhooth Bangla Advance Booking Report: 12K+ Tickets Sold In National Chains As Paid Previews Witness Strong Late-Night Surge

BY CHRISTA LINCY

The anticipation for Akshay Kumar's return to the horror-comedy genre is beginning to reflect at the box office as the advance booking for Bhooth Bangla officially opens. Slated for a grand release, the film is set to kickstart its journey with special paid previews starting from 9 PM onwards on April 16, 2026. Early trends suggest that the audience is particularly keen on these late-night screenings, with the national chains showing a consistent upward trajectory in ticket sales throughout the day. For the opening day, Bhooth Bangla has recorded an initial all-India advance booking gross of ₹14.3 Lac (excluding block seats). When including block seats, the figure significantly jumps to approximately ₹40 Lac, indicating that exhibitors are optimistic about a strong turnout. The film has currently sold over 8,214 tickets for Day 1 across 3,005 shows with an average ticket price of ₹226. While the numbers are in the early stages, the momentum gathered in the final hours of Tuesday suggests a healthy opening is on the cards. The performance in National Chains (PVR, INOX, and Cinepolis) has been the highlight of the day. The Paid Previews, in particular, saw a massive jump in interest. Starting with nearly 2,000 tickets sold by Tuesday morning, the count surged to over 4,300 by the evening and finally settled at approximately 6,200 tickets by late night. This evening surge for paid previews showcases a clear preference for the night-owl audience. Similarly, Day 1 advance bookings in these chains showed strong momentum, growing from around 2,800 tickets in the afternoon to over 5,600 by the close of the day. (adsbygoogle = window.adsbygoogle || []).push({}) Bhooth Bangla Day 1: Top Performing States (Advance Booking)STATEGROSS (WITH BLOCK SEATS)SHOWSGujarat₹ 9.74 Lac489Delhi₹ 6.26 Lac510Madhya Pradesh₹ 5.74 Lac175Maharashtra₹ 5.35 Lac524Rajasthan₹ 3.97 Lac185West Bengal₹ 3.04 Lac177 On a regional level, West Bengal is currently leading the pack with an impressive 26 percent occupancy for its initial show count. Other major markets like Madhya Pradesh, Maharashtra, and Delhi are also showing steady movement, primarily in premium properties. Combined with the paid previews, the total ticket sales in national chains have crossed the 12,000 mark within the first 24 hours of full-scale booking. With BookMyShow recording nearly 7,000 new interests in just a single day, the buzz around Bhooth Bangla is expected to intensify as the film approaches its Thursday night previews and the big Friday release.

Dhurandhar 2 The Revenge Day 27 Box Office Collection: Massive 35% Spike On 4th Tuesday; Closing In On Pushpa 2 To Claim All-Time Top 3 Worldwide Spot

BY CHRISTA LINCY

The box office juggernaut Dhurandhar 2: The Revenge has once again defied the usual weekday trend by witnessing a significant surge on its twenty-seventh day. Benefiting from the national holiday of Ambedkar Jayanti on April 14, the film saw a sharp spike in footfalls across major territories in India. After a standard Monday dip, the fourth Tuesday performance has reignited the momentum for this cinematic spectacle as it marches toward unprecedented global milestones. On Day 27, Dhurandhar 2: The Revenge recorded a net collection of ₹7.05 Cr in India across 10,143 shows. This represents a healthy growth of approximately 35 percent compared to its previous day net collection of ₹5.20 Cr. The Hindi version remains the primary driver of this success, contributing ₹6.75 Cr to the daily total. The holiday factor was clearly visible in the ticket sales momentum, with BookMyShow registering 107.92K tickets on Tuesday, surpassing the Monday figure of 103.97K. Furthermore, the advance booking in national chains saw a substantial jump to 36.4K tickets, signaling a strong recovery and keeping the momentum back on track. Dhurandhar 2 Day 27 Language-wise BreakdownLANGUAGEINDIA NET (DAY 27)Hindi₹ 6.75 CrTelugu₹ 0.15 CrTamil₹ 0.10 CrKannada₹ 0.05 CrTotal₹ 7.05 Cr The cumulative totals for the film have reached staggering heights as it nears the end of its fourth week. The total India net collection now stands at ₹1,095.67 Cr, while the India gross has hit ₹1,311.68 Cr. On the global front, the film found stable ground in international markets even without the benefit of a weekday holiday. After Monday saw the overseas collection dip into the lakhs at 0.75 Cr, it managed a slight recovery to reach the 1.00 Cr mark on Tuesday. This takes the total overseas gross to ₹416.25 Cr, pushing the massive worldwide gross collection to ₹1,727.93 Cr. With this performance, Dhurandhar 2: The Revenge has firmly established itself as the 4th highest-grossing Indian film of all time globally. It is now closing in rapidly on the lifetime collection of Pushpa 2: The Rule, which holds the 3rd position with ₹1,742.10 Cr. Based on the current trend and the renewed momentum, the film is projected to surpass the Pushpa 2 record by the conclusion of its fourth week this Thursday or by Friday to claim its spot on the all-time podium. (adsbygoogle = window.adsbygoogle || []).push({}) Milestone Tracker: The Road to Worldwide Top 3 DHURANDHAR 2 (₹ 1,727.93 Cr) - 99.18% OF TARGET REACHED RANKMOVIE NAMEWORLDWIDE GROSS 1Dangal₹ 2,070.30 Cr 2Baahubali 2₹ 1,788.06 Cr 3Pushpa 2: The Rule₹ 1,742.10 Cr 4Dhurandhar 2: The Revenge₹ 1,727.93 Cr REMAINING GAP: ₹ 14.17 Cr Given the current trajectory and the significant Tuesday spike, the film is moving with high velocity toward this milestone. Even with a natural stabilization expected after the holiday, a remaining gap of 14.17 Cr is likely to be bridged by the conclusion of its fourth week this Thursday or by Friday morning to claim its spot on the all-time podium. This would make Dhurandhar 2: The Revenge only the third Indian film in history to cross the 1,745 Cr mark, further cementing the legacy of this franchise on the global stage. Fans are keeping a close watch on the daily numbers as the film prepares to rewrite the all-time record books. When looking at the historical context of Day 27 Hindi net collections, Dhurandhar 2: The Revenge maintains a dominant position among the highest earners of all time. While it trails behind the first installment which earned 11.00 Cr on its twenty-seventh day, it has successfully outperformed other recent heavyweights like Pushpa 2: The Rule and Chhaava. With a total of 17.32 million tickets sold on BookMyShow so far, the film continues its historic run as an All Time Blockbuster, consistently drawing crowds even after nearly a month in theaters. Top 5 Movies - Day 27 Hindi Net ComparisonMOVIE NAMEDAY 27 HINDI NETDhurandhar₹ 11.00 CrDhurandhar 2: The Revenge₹ 6.75 CrPushpa: The Rule - Part 2₹ 6.25 CrChhaava₹ 4.00 CrStree 2₹ 3.10 Cr

Ek Din Advance Booking: Junaid Khan and Sai Pallavi's Next Opens a Record 39 Days Early; Bollywood Shifts to New Psychological Release Strategy

BY CHRISTA LINCY

There is a fascinating new trend taking over the Hindi film circuit as the industry moves toward a high-stakes release strategy for the upcoming film Ek Din. Starring Junaid Khan and Sai Pallavi, the project has officially made headlines by opening its advance bookings a staggering 39 days before its theatrical debut. According to reports from Bollywood Hungama, this rollout began on April 11, marking a complete shift from the traditional Hindi film playbook where ticket sales usually only kick off a few days before the first show. This move is being viewed as a bold psychological operation intended to create a sense of importance before the audience even steps into the theater. The early numbers, while modest in volume, are providing a fascinating look at the film's regional pull during this experimental phase. By April 11, the movie had already moved over 520 tickets across India, with specific centers showing surprising early interest. For instance, PVR City Center in Raipur led the way with 46 tickets sold, followed by 37 at PVR Palladium Mall in Ahmedabad and 18 at Inox Orion Mall in Gorakhpur. This initial wave is currently limited to approximately 20 cities, including major hubs like Delhi-NCR and Mumbai, all serving as a strategic build-up to the official worldwide release on May 1, 2026. By tracking these early-wave screenings, the makers are able to gauge city-wise chatter long before the traditional marketing blitz begins. The scale of this early launch is highly calculated and specific. Data shared by Bollywood Hungama reveals that the bookings have gone live across nearly 20 major cities, but with a deliberate restraint: most participating cinemas have opened just one show per screen. This strategy is less about flooding the market with tickets and more about engineering a signal of high demand. In an era where attention is the most unstable currency in Bollywood, the makers are essentially trying to build an aura around the film, treating the booking window as a media device to spark city-wise chatter well in advance. (adsbygoogle = window.adsbygoogle || []).push({}) This long-lead approach highlights a growing nervousness within the theatrical ecosystem, where perception often determines a film's fate before Friday morning. By front-loading the importance of Ek Din, the industry is attempting to manufacture inevitability. The logic here is to plant curiosity early and test market responsiveness rather than relying on a last-minute marketing burst. In today’s Bollywood, where social media narratives are assembled with alarming speed, having early booking numbers to showcase can become a powerful weapon in the ongoing war for public interest. The ultimate takeaway from this 39-day gamble is how crucial it has become for a film to be framed as an event long before it has proved itself to be one. While a release used to be enough, 2026 demands that a film carries a pre-sold significance. Whether this slow-burn conversation translates into actual sustained footfalls remains to be seen, but for now, Ek Din is successfully rewriting the rules. It shows that Bollywood is no longer content to let a movie breathe naturally; instead, it wants to reduce uncertainty by capturing the audience's attention the moment the first ticket becomes available.
